How much is the Quinsigamond CC tuition? For the academic year 2023-2024, Quinsigamond CC's tuition & fees is $5,974 for Massachusetts residents and $10,918 for out-of-state students.
With indirect costs not billed by school, such as room & boards and personal living expenses, the total cost of attendance for one academic year is $20,472 for Massachusetts residents and $25,416 for out-of-state students when a student lives off-campus.

Financial Aid and COA

At Quinsigamond Community College, 4,897 students (71%) received grant or scholarship from the federal government, state or local government, the institution, and other sources. The average amount of grant/scholarship received is $4,602.
After receiving financial aid, the cost of attendance (COA) at Quinsigamond CC is $20,814 for students living off-campus.
For beginning students (i.e. first-time freshmen), 550 students received any type of financial aid including grants/scholarship and student loans. The average amount of grant/scholarship for the first-time students is $6,635 and the average amount of student loans is $5,103.
The financial aid data is based on 2021-2022 statistics from IPEDS.

Student Population

Quinsigamond Community College has a total of 6,481 students (all undergraduate). By gender, there are 2,509 male students and 4,407 female students attending Quinsigamond CC. The school offers online degree programs and 1,275 students enrolled online exclusively (19.67% of all students).
